There are 50 games available and they include some that have never been on Linux before - FlatOut, Darklands, Realms of the Haunting - as well as some new games only just out, Gods Will Be Watching among them. There's a special Linux Launch - Special Promo! sale in celebration.
Distro-independent tar.gz archives and DEB installers for the two most popular Linux distributions - Ubuntu and Mint - will be provided, both in their current and future LTS editions. Whew! Did I say that right? GOG's helpdesk will offer Linux support from today as well.
